发明名称 GALECTIN-1 SECRETED FROM MESENCHYMAL STEM CELLS MODULATES EXTRACELLULAR α-SYNUCLEIN BY INHIBITING TRANSMISSION VIA CLATHRIN-MEDIATED ENDOCYTOSIS
摘要 The present invention relates to a method for treating Parkinson′s disease associated with aggregation of alpha-synuclein. More specifically, regulation of N-methyl-D-aspartate (NMDA) receptors on a cell surface using galectin-1 derived from mesenchymal stem cells brings inhibition of clathrin-mediated endocytosis (CME) of extracellular alpha-synuclein, thereby blocking formation of alpha-synuclein aggregates. Thus, it is possible to treat or prevent disease such as Parkinson′s disease induced by alpha-synuclein aggregation.
